I have been working as an outpatient Physiotherapist for over 30 years. I have since gained my BSc in Psychology, and this compliments my practice as a Specialised Physiotherapist.
I have a specialised interest in pain education and management, attending regular postgraduate courses. I have completed Pilates instructor matwork level 3 training with the APPI and am currently teaching clinical Pilates here at Perform Physiotherapy. I also have an interest in treating clients with vestibular balance dysfunctions, including benign positional vertigo.
I have over 30 years of practical experience treating both Inpatients on the ward and outpatients in the Physiotherapy Perform department, treating thousands of patients in that time.
